Внимание!
Не все расширения для phpBB 3.2 совместимы с phpBB 3.3, главным образом из-за неверного синтаксиса в определениях сервисов (отсутствия обрамляющих кавычек - '...').
Перед обновлением необходимо убедиться в совместимости всех расширений.
Рекомендуется предварительно тестировать обновление на копии конференции (локально или на сервере).

[3.1][3.2][release] Profile side switcher - Минипрофили слева

Все расширения, созданные нашим сообществом для phpBB, как находящиеся в разработке, так и прошедшие валидацию на официальном сайте phpbb.com, будут анонсированы тут. Вся техническая поддержка по этим расширениям оказывается в этом форуме.
Правила форума
Местная Конституция | Шаблон запроса | Документация (phpBB3) | Мини [FAQ] по phpBB3.1.x/3.3.x | FAQ | Как задавать вопросы | Как устанавливать расширения

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ение ;) ).
Аватара пользователя
Татьяна5
Поддержка
Поддержка
Сообщения: 9952
Зарегистрирован: 08.08.2011 2:02
Благодарил (а): 176 раз
Поблагодарили: 2765 раз

[3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Татьяна5 »

Название: Profile side switcher

Описание: Расширение позволяет переключится на лево/правостороннее расположение минипрофилей в личном разделе и/или со страниц тем.
По умолчанию минипрофили будут отображаться слева.
Скриншоты 
pss3.gif
pss3.gif (10.76 КБ) 16525 просмотров
pss2.gif
pss2.gif (10.1 КБ) 16525 просмотров
pss1.gif
Версия 1.0.1
  • Полностью совместима с 3.1 и 3.2
  • Исправлена ошибка с неменяющимся текстом в нижнем меню
  • Нестандартный стили для 3.1 теперь скачиваются отдельно https://github.com/Tatiana5/profile_sid ... styles-3.1
Скриншот из 3.2
2017-08-02_021343.jpg
2017-08-02_021343.jpg (18.54 КБ) 7956 просмотров

GitHub репозиторий: https://github.com/Tatiana5/profile_side_switcher/
Загрузить расширение: https://github.com/Tatiana5/profile_sid ... master.zip

Страница расширения на официальном сайте phpbb.com: https://www.phpbb.com/customise/db/exte ... _switcher/.
=======================
МОД для версии phpbb 3.0.12 Перенос профилей налево/направо в один клик (Prosilver)
Последний раз редактировалось Татьяна5 15.01.2020 5:09, всего редактировалось 2 раза.

Перенесено из форума Бета-версии расширений для phpBB 3.1.x в форум Анонсы и поддержка расширений для phpBB 3.1.x 11.07.2015 12:48 модератором LavIgor

Аватара пользователя
Pazh
Former team member
Сообщения: 2194
Зарегистрирован: 09.11.2009 17:46
Благодарил (а): 41 раз
Поблагодарили: 455 раз

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Pazh »

static77, у тебя на форуме могут быть включены другие языки (смотри админку - вкладка Персонализация - Языковые пакеты), локализации стиля для которых нет в расширении - Sheer про это тебе пытается сказать.

А вообще - не плохо было бы удалить папку production в папке cache напрямую через панель хостинга или ftp. И потом посмотреть будет ли ошибка.
А еще лучше - переустановить расширение заново, т.к. "если все файлы расширения на месте", то подобной ошибки быть не может физически (судя по коду расширения)
форум ЖК Вестердам Помощь в ЛС/email только за WM или ЯД

Аватара пользователя
Татьяна5
Поддержка
Поддержка
Сообщения: 9952
Зарегистрирован: 08.08.2011 2:02
Благодарил (а): 176 раз
Поблагодарили: 2765 раз

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Татьяна5 »

Pazh
Может, если до объявления переменной дело по какой-либо причине не доходит (непонятно, то ли строка в ошибке обрезана, то ли переменная периодически оказывается пустой)

Аватара пользователя
Sheer
phpBB Guru
phpBB Guru
Сообщения: 11541
Зарегистрирован: 18.02.2007 19:01
Откуда: Калининград не Кенигсберг
Благодарил (а): 53 раза
Поблагодарили: 2594 раза

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Sheer »

Вот это и непонятно, почему $style_lang_path оказывается пусто. Не иначе, как какое-то расширение гадит.
В таком случае я бы сделал
Открыть ext\tatiana5\profilesideswitcher\event\listener.php
Найти

Код: Выделить всё

		$this->template->assign_vars(array(
			'T_PSS_STYLESHEET_LANG_LINK'	=> $style_lang_path,
		));
Добавить перед

Код: Выделить всё

		if (!$style_lang_path)
		{
			$style_lang_path = 'prosilver/theme/' . $this->config['default_lang'] . '/profile_side_switcher.css';
		}
Изображение
Общие ошибки новичков (07.11.2005) & Как задавать вопросы
Мини FAQ
Если ничто другое не помогает, прочтите, наконец, инструкцию!
"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ения".
Циркуляр Морского технического комитета №15 от 29.11.1910 г.

Аватара пользователя
Pazh
Former team member
Сообщения: 2194
Зарегистрирован: 09.11.2009 17:46
Благодарил (а): 41 раз
Поблагодарили: 455 раз

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Pazh »

Татьяна5, согласен, но это возможно только если до события core.page_header_after не сработало, тогда ошибки какие-то раньше были бы в логах - теоретически
Последний раз редактировалось Pazh 25.03.2019 16:21, всего редактировалось 1 раз.
форум ЖК Вестердам Помощь в ЛС/email только за WM или ЯД

Аватара пользователя
Sheer
phpBB Guru
phpBB Guru
Сообщения: 11541
Зарегистрирован: 18.02.2007 19:01
Откуда: Калининград не Кенигсберг
Благодарил (а): 53 раза
Поблагодарили: 2594 раза

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Sheer »

static77 писал(а):
25.03.2019 13:51
регулярно
А регулярно, это по всей видимости когда заходит поисковый бот, при этом форум падает с фатальной ошибкой.
Изображение
Общие ошибки новичков (07.11.2005) & Как задавать вопросы
Мини FAQ
Если ничто другое не помогает, прочтите, наконец, инструкцию!
"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ения".
Циркуляр Морского технического комитета №15 от 29.11.1910 г.

static77
phpBB 1.4.4
Сообщения: 188
Зарегистрирован: 25.01.2016 10:29
Благодарил (а): 90 раз
Поблагодарили: 4 раза

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ение static77 »

Pazh писал(а):
25.03.2019 15:47
у тебя на форуме могут быть включены другие языки
как это у меня на моем форуме будут включены другие языки? я для чего на форуме админ?
Sheer спросил какие языки установлены и какие используются - я ответил конкретно на заданные вопросы. ;)
Версия phpBB: 3.2.9

Аватара пользователя
Pazh
Former team member
Сообщения: 2194
Зарегистрирован: 09.11.2009 17:46
Благодарил (а): 41 раз
Поблагодарили: 455 раз

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Pazh »

Sheer, У Татьяны там стоит проверка - какой бы кривой стиль и язык не стоял бы у бота/юзера должно было бы на крайняк сработать это prosilver/theme/en/profile_side_switcher.css
Соответственно или в папке расширения в папке styles/prosilver/theme/en/ нет файла profile_side_switcher.css или хз
форум ЖК Вестердам Помощь в ЛС/email только за WM или ЯД

static77
phpBB 1.4.4
Сообщения: 188
Зарегистрирован: 25.01.2016 10:29
Благодарил (а): 90 раз
Поблагодарили: 4 раза

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ение static77 »

Sheer писал(а):
25.03.2019 16:21
А регулярно, это по всей видимости когда заходит поисковый бот, при этом форум падает с фатальной ошибкой.
форум вроде не падает, если я правильно понимаю значение сего выражения
по времени: 23-Mar-2019 17:54:00 UTC, 23-Mar-2019 18:23:03 UTC, 23-Mar-2019 18:23:56 UTC, 23-Mar-2019 18:25:37 UTC и тд. иногда чаще, иногда реже.
Может когда чищу кэш через админку? в последнее время нужно было постоянно чистить?
Версия phpBB: 3.2.9

Аватара пользователя
Pazh
Former team member
Сообщения: 2194
Зарегистрирован: 09.11.2009 17:46
Благодарил (а): 41 раз
Поблагодарили: 455 раз

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Pazh »

static77, ищи под каким юзером возникает эта ошибка (например по ip из лога сервера и поиск по ip на форуме), пробуй зайти под ним и воспроизвести ошибку
форум ЖК Вестердам Помощь в ЛС/email только за WM или ЯД

static77
phpBB 1.4.4
Сообщения: 188
Зарегистрирован: 25.01.2016 10:29
Благодарил (а): 90 раз
Поблагодарили: 4 раза

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ение static77 »

Pazh, скорее всего ХЗ.
Версия phpBB: 3.2.9

Аватара пользователя
Sheer
phpBB Guru
phpBB Guru
Сообщения: 11541
Зарегистрирован: 18.02.2007 19:01
Откуда: Калининград не Кенигсберг
Благодарил (а): 53 раза
Поблагодарили: 2594 раза

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Sheer »

Вот именно хз, без доступа к файлам не поймешь. Тогда костыль такой: в overall_header_head_append.html пихать проверку типо

Код: Выделить всё

<!-- INCLUDECSS @tatiana5_profilesideswitcher/profile_side_switcher.css -->
<!-- IF T_PSS_STYLESHEET_LANG_LINK -->
<!-- INCLUDECSS @tatiana5_profilesideswitcher/../../{T_PSS_STYLESHEET_LANG_LINK} -->
<!-- ELSE -->
<!-- INCLUDECSS @tatiana5_profilesideswitcher/../../prosilver/theme/en/profile_side_switcher.css
<!-- ENDIF -->
Изображение
Общие ошибки новичков (07.11.2005) & Как задавать вопросы
Мини FAQ
Если ничто другое не помогает, прочтите, наконец, инструкцию!
"Никакая инструкция не может перечислить всех обязанностей должностного лица, предусмотреть все отдельные случаи и дать вперёд соответствующие указания, а поэтому господа инженеры должны проявить инициативу и, руководствуясь знаниями своей специальности и пользой дела, принять все усилия для оправдания своего назначения".
Циркуляр Морского технического комитета №15 от 29.11.1910 г.

Аватара пользователя
Татьяна5
Поддержка
Поддержка
Сообщения: 9952
Зарегистрирован: 08.08.2011 2:02
Благодарил (а): 176 раз
Поблагодарили: 2765 раз

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Татьяна5 »

Pazh писал(а):
25.03.2019 16:20
Татьяна5, согласен, но это возможно только если до события core.page_header_after не сработало, тогда ошибки какие-то раньше были бы в логах - теоретически
Не факт что были бы ошибки
Эн-ное расширение могло отдать ответ через аякс, а до моего дело не дошло (это к примеру)

static77, да, ищите под кем можно воспроизвести ошибку (и при каких действиях, это из access_log иногда понять можно)

Аватара пользователя
Pazh
Former team member
Сообщения: 2194
Зарегистрирован: 09.11.2009 17:46
Благодарил (а): 41 раз
Поблагодарили: 455 раз

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Pazh »

Татьяна5 писал(а):
25.03.2019 16:33
Эн-ное расширение могло отдать ответ через аякс
написал про это, а потом стер - видать мыслил правильно :)
форум ЖК Вестердам Помощь в ЛС/email только за WM или ЯД

Аватара пользователя
Татьяна5
Поддержка
Поддержка
Сообщения: 9952
Зарегистрирован: 08.08.2011 2:02
Благодарил (а): 176 раз
Поблагодарили: 2765 раз

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ение Татьяна5 »

static77 писал(а):
25.03.2019 16:28
Pazh, скорее всего ХЗ.
error_log - время
access_log - все остальные данные по этому времени

static77
phpBB 1.4.4
Сообщения: 188
Зарегистрирован: 25.01.2016 10:29
Благодарил (а): 90 раз
Поблагодарили: 4 раза

Re: [3.1][3.2][release] Profile side switcher - Минипрофили слева

Сообщение static77 »

Sheer писал(а):
25.03.2019 16:18
Открыть ext\tatiana5\profilesideswitcher\event\listener.php
добавил. теперь нужно подождать и посмотреть.
Версия phpBB: 3.2.9

Вернуться в «Анонсы и поддержка расширений для phpBB»